## Changelog — Ledgerpane audit viewer

Heads up for the sync: we flipped some defaults in Ledgerpane. Retention filter now defaults to 90 days instead of "all time" (page loads were brutal), and redacted fields are hidden by default rather than masked. Export stays admin-only. Existing saved views are untouched. The new default config shipped with this release reads as follows.

deployment values, yadug-bawif:
[framir]
team = pelox
access_code = ac_a38ab2
owner = tamion.julael
host = framir.tolvaqlabs.test
port = 11211
peer = tammir.zemvargrid.local
salt = 2215ef03
pin = 1541

Cleaning crews from Brightmoor Services may access office floors only between 18:30 and 22:00, and must sign the visitor ledger at the Ashfell Tower front desk on arrival and departure. Team assistants should confirm the crew roster each Monday and report discrepancies promptly. Crews enter the service corridor using the code below.

turnstile pass: bdg-YPPQB-52010

# Build Provenance: UI Snapshot Tests

Snapshot images for Duskpane components are generated only on the sealed Ironvale runners, never on developer machines. Each snapshot commit must trace to a signed pipeline run; unsigned updates are rejected at merge. Reviewers: verify the renderer version matches the lockfile and that no snapshot was hand-edited. Provenance for the current snapshot set resolves to the token below.

trace token, fafog-kageg: htk4_98e6

Sales leads should be aware that Vantrel Industries will reduce marketing spend by 18% for the second half of the fiscal year. The Brightline campaign in the Calden region will be paused, while digital outreach for the Orvis product line continues at reduced scale. Regional co-op funds remain intact, though approval thresholds drop. Please align pipeline forecasts with these constraints before the review with Director Halloway. The rationale behind the reduction is outlined in the note below.

internal memo for hahif-hahaf: Headcount on the Zorwyn team goes from 9 to 100 by the end of October. Gross margin on Zorwyn came in at 5 percent against a plan of 10 percent.